[学习笔记] MySQL数据库基础之MySQL概述
# 学习 # · 2021-11-01
数据库基础
1、数据库(DataBase,DB):存储数据的仓库,数据是有组织的进行存储。
2、数据库管理系统(DataBase Management System,DBMS):操作和管理数据库的大型软件,其功能包括数据定义、数据库操作、数据库运行管理、数据组织,存储和管理、数据库的简历和维护、其他功能。
3、SQL(Structured Query Language):操作关系型数据库的编程语言,定义了一套操作关系型数据库统一标准。
4、数据库的分类:
- a、关系型数据库:如Oracle、MySQL等。
- b、非关系型数据库:如Redis、MongoDB等。
5、主流关系数据库:
- a、Oracle:大型的收费数据库,Oracle公司产品,价格昂贵。
- b、MySQL:开源免费的中小型数据库。
- c、SQL Server:Microsoft 公司推出的收费的中型数据库。
- d、PostgreSQL:开源免费的中小型数据库。
- e、SQL Lite:嵌入式的微型数据库。
MySQL数据库
1、MySQL下载与安装:https://downloads.mysql.com/archives/installer/
2、连接到MySQL数据库:
- a、方式一:使用MySQL提供的客户端命令行工具。
- b、方式二:使用系统自带的命令行工具执行指令。
- c、方式三:使用第三方工具(如:Navicat)连接。
-
-----
##### 关系型数据库(RDBMS)
1、关系型数据库概念:建立在关系模型基础上,由多张相互连接的二维表组成的数据库。
2、二维表:由行和列组成的表。
3、关系型数据库的特点:
- a、使用表存储数据,格式统一,便于维护。
- b、使用SQL语言操作,标准统一,使用方便。
-----
##### 数据模型
1、通过MySQL客户端连接数据库管理系统DBMS,然后通过DBMS操作数据库。
2、以使用SQL语句,通过数据库管理系统操作数据库,以及操作数据库中的表结构及数据。
如无特殊说明,本博所有文章均为博主原创。
如若转载,请注明出处:一木林多 - https://www.l5v.cn/archives/336/
如若转载,请注明出处:一木林多 - https://www.l5v.cn/archives/336/
评论